Oklahoma City is a 10-point favorite over Indiana at DraftKings Sportsbook, with a total of 230 points.
Betting Splits

The Thunder are significant favorites in Game 1 of the NBA Finals against the Pacers. The Thunder have been the best team in the NBA all season and seem unstoppable at the moment. The Pacers have had an incredible run through the Eastern Conference playoffs, but could be in the “happy to be here” zone. The Thunder have been incredible at home this postseason and are deservedly big favorites against the Pacers.
The Pacers are 10-point underdogs in this game, and the public seems to think that is too many points. 59% of the bets are on Indiana to cover the large spread. However, bigger bettors are coming in on the other side. Despite getting only 41% of the bets, 59% of the handle is on the Thunder to cover the large spread. Bigger bettors are not afraid of the double-digit number, and are backing Oklahoma City to make a statement in Game 1.
With a spread of this size, the moneyline isn’t as popular a bet as it would be if it were a tighter spread. 52% of the bets and 52% of the handle are on the Thunder moneyline. That is a lot of juice to pay, so most Thunder bettors are leaning on the spread, rather than that expensive moneyline. When it comes to the total, bettors are leaning towards the over 230. 60% of bets and 64% of the handle are on the over, meaning the public likes the over, and bigger bettors agree.
Most Popular Player Props
Here are five of the most popular player prop bets at DraftKings Sportsbook for this matchup:
- Shai Gilgeous-Alexander First Points Scorer (+390)
- Pascal Siakam First Points Scorer (+650)
- Alex Caruso Points + Rebounds + Assists u14.5 (-135)
- Shai Gilgeous-Alexander 35+ Points (+115)
- Tyrese Haliburton u17.5 Points (-125)
NBA MVP Shai Gilgeous-Alexander is always popular in the prop market. The most-bet player prop for Game 1 of the NBA Finals is on SGA to score the first points of the game. The MVP would love to set the tone from the jump and get the first bucket of the game. The second most popular player prop bet is on Pascal Siakam to score the first points of the game. Siakam won the Eastern Conference Finals MVP and was the Pacers’ most consistent offensive threat all series against the Knicks.
The public is also going against Alex Caruso in this game. Caruso has been fantastic for the Thunder in these playoffs, but his contributions often don’t end up in the stat sheet. Caruso is an elite defender and can guard all five positions. He has taken on both Anthony Edwards and Nikola Jokic this postseason, and makes all of the little plays that help the Thunder win games. However, the public thinks he will stay under his combined stats prop.
On the other hand, the public is backing Gilgeous-Alexander to have a big game. He has been phenomenal all season and the public thinks he can score 35 or more points in Game 1 of the Finals. For the Pacers’ star, the public has little faith in Tyrese Haliburton. They are betting on Haliburton to have under 17.5 points. Haliburton has been brilliant for the Pacers this postseason, but he has been inconsistent with his scoring. Against the elite Thunder defense, he could struggle to get over 17.5 points.
